Short definition
The GLOCK 21 Gen5 MOS is a full-size, striker-fired .45 ACP duty/defensive pistol from Glock’s Gen5 family with the MOS (Modular Optic System) plate — factory optics-ready, rugged polymer frame, Glock Marksman Barrel (GMB), and Gen-5 ergonomic/operational updates for modern service and carry use.
GLOCK 21 GEN5 MOS
-
Caliber: .45 ACP
-
Action / System: Striker-fired (Glock Safe Action)
-
Capacity: 13 + 1 (standard)
-
Barrel length: 117 mm / 4.61 in (Glock Marksman Barrel)
-
Overall length: ~205 mm / 8.07 in
-
Weight (unloaded): ~735 g / 25.9 oz
-
Slide / Finish: Optics-ready MOS slide with removable mounting plates; nDLC/black finish typical
-
Sights: Factory fixed sights; optics option via MOS plate
-
Notable Gen5 features: No finger grooves, reversible magazine catch, ambidextrous slide stop, improved marksman barrel
-
Country of manufacture: Austria
